Day 01, Saturday: Arrive Dublin

Morning arrival at Dublin Airport. It will be too early to check into your hotel. Driver will give you a panoramic tour of Dublin to get your bearings. Drop your bags at the hotel and some free time to explore the capital city on your own. Return back to hotel for a night of entertainment at the Irish House Party, where you will have dinner as a group with traditional Irish entertainment.

Day 02, Sunday: Dublin - Galway

Following breakfast, depart Dublin and travel the short journey to Galway, where we check into our hotel. Free time to rest. In the afternoon, we enjoy a local panoramic sightseeing tour of Galway City. Dinner and overnight in Galway.

Day 03, Monday: Dublin - Galway

Today we make our way out to Connemara. Travel along Galway Bay to Maam Cross and Clifden. Continue on via Kylemore Abbey and stop briefly for a photo opportunity. We continue via scenic countryside; keep an eye out for sheep en route to Moycullen. We stop to visit the Celtic Crystal Factory. Our evening is free to enjoy Galway, with dinner on your own. Overnight in Galway.

Day 04, Tuesday: Galway - Cliffs of Moher - Killarney

Morning departure from Galway. We make our way to the awe inspiring and majestic Cliffs of Moher, which rise 700 feet above the Atlantic Ocean. A spectacular day with great sea and cliff views, before making our way to Killarney for dinner and overnight.

Day 05, Wednesday: Killarney - Dingle Peninsula

A delightful day takes us along the Kerry coast to the Dingle Peninsula, which offers magnificent coastal scenery. Beyond Slea Head, we see the Blasket Islands, the last outpost of Europe. A full day tour returning to Killarney, where we enjoy an evening and dinner on your own. Overnight in Killarney.

Day 06, Thursday: Killarney - Cashel - Dublin

Leaving Killarney, we travel over the mountains to Blarney, where we pause for a visit to Blarney Woollen Mills. Here you have time to enjoy an optional visit to Blarney Castle, and perhaps kiss the famed Blarney Stone. Leaving Blarney, we travel via Tipperary and Cashel, where we pause for a photo-op at the historic Rock of Cashel. Arrive in Dublin, check into your castle hotel and dinner is on your own tonight.

Day 07, Friday: Dublin

Coming into the capital city this morning for sightseeing. We visit the Guinness Storehouse, enjoying panoramic views of the city from the Gravity Bar, followed by your choice of visiting either the EPIC Museum. Some free time then to enjoy the capital city independently. Dublin has plenty of shops, cafes, museums, and more for you to enjoy. This evening, we enjoy a farewell dinner at our castle hotel in Killiney, Co. Dublin.

Day 08, Saturday: Dublin - U.S.

Early morning transfer to Dublin Airport for your return flight home. Flights to the U.S. arrive home the same day.

Why Halloween in Ireland?

Halloween originated in Ireland as Samhain, an ancient Celtic festival marking the thinning of the veil between worlds.
